LCOV - code coverage report
Current view: top level - control_plane/src - pageserver.rs (source / functions) Coverage Total Hit
Test: aca8877be6ceba750c1be359ed71bc1799d52b30.info Lines: 82.9 % 510 423
Test Date: 2024-02-14 18:05:35 Functions: 65.9 % 85 56

Function Name Sort by function name Hit count Sort by function hit count
<control_plane::pageserver::PageServerNode as core::fmt::Debug>::fmt 0
<control_plane::pageserver::PageServerNode>::check_status 2566
::check_status 1283
::check_status::{closure#0} 1283
<control_plane::pageserver::PageServerNode>::from_env 2716
<control_plane::pageserver::PageServerNode>::initialize 400
<control_plane::pageserver::PageServerNode>::initialize::{closure#0} 0
<control_plane::pageserver::PageServerNode>::location_config 0
<control_plane::pageserver::PageServerNode>::location_config::{closure#0} 0
<control_plane::pageserver::PageServerNode>::neon_local_overrides 1026
<control_plane::pageserver::PageServerNode>::neon_local_overrides::{closure#0} 1031
<control_plane::pageserver::PageServerNode>::neon_local_overrides::{closure#1} 1186
<control_plane::pageserver::PageServerNode>::page_server_psql_client 6
<control_plane::pageserver::PageServerNode>::page_server_psql_client::{closure#0} 6
<control_plane::pageserver::PageServerNode>::pageserver_basic_args 1026
<control_plane::pageserver::PageServerNode>::pageserver_env_variables 1026
<control_plane::pageserver::PageServerNode>::pageserver_init 400
<control_plane::pageserver::PageServerNode>::pageserver_init::{closure#0} 0
<control_plane::pageserver::PageServerNode>::pageserver_init::{closure#1} 0
<control_plane::pageserver::PageServerNode>::parse_config 461
<control_plane::pageserver::PageServerNode>::parse_config::{closure#0} 156
<control_plane::pageserver::PageServerNode>::parse_config::{closure#10} 0
<control_plane::pageserver::PageServerNode>::parse_config::{closure#11} 0
<control_plane::pageserver::PageServerNode>::parse_config::{closure#12} 1
<control_plane::pageserver::PageServerNode>::parse_config::{closure#13} 2
<control_plane::pageserver::PageServerNode>::parse_config::{closure#14} 1
<control_plane::pageserver::PageServerNode>::parse_config::{closure#15} 0
<control_plane::pageserver::PageServerNode>::parse_config::{closure#16} 0
<control_plane::pageserver::PageServerNode>::parse_config::{closure#17} 0
<control_plane::pageserver::PageServerNode>::parse_config::{closure#1} 2
<control_plane::pageserver::PageServerNode>::parse_config::{closure#2} 72
<control_plane::pageserver::PageServerNode>::parse_config::{closure#3} 148
<control_plane::pageserver::PageServerNode>::parse_config::{closure#4} 30
<control_plane::pageserver::PageServerNode>::parse_config::{closure#5} 5
<control_plane::pageserver::PageServerNode>::parse_config::{closure#6} 150
<control_plane::pageserver::PageServerNode>::parse_config::{closure#7} 142
<control_plane::pageserver::PageServerNode>::parse_config::{closure#8} 25
<control_plane::pageserver::PageServerNode>::parse_config::{closure#9} 0
<control_plane::pageserver::PageServerNode>::pid_file 1252
<control_plane::pageserver::PageServerNode>::repo_path 2278
<control_plane::pageserver::PageServerNode>::start 1252
::start 626
::start::{closure#0} 626
<control_plane::pageserver::PageServerNode>::start_node 626
<control_plane::pageserver::PageServerNode>::start_node::{closure#0} 626
<control_plane::pageserver::PageServerNode>::start_node::{closure#0}::{closure#0} 0
<control_plane::pageserver::PageServerNode>::start_node::{closure#0}::{closure#1} 1283
<control_plane::pageserver::PageServerNode>::start_node::{closure#0}::{closure#1}::{closure#0} 1283
<control_plane::pageserver::PageServerNode>::stop 626
<control_plane::pageserver::PageServerNode>::tenant_config 14
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0} 14
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#0} 5
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#10} 0
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#11} 1
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#12} 0
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#13} 0
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#14} 4
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#15} 0
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#16} 0
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#17} 0
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#1} 4
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#2} 4
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#3} 5
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#4} 5
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#5} 2
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#6} 5
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#7} 6
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#8} 5
<control_plane::pageserver::PageServerNode>::tenant_config::{closure#0}::{closure#9} 0
<control_plane::pageserver::PageServerNode>::tenant_create 0
<control_plane::pageserver::PageServerNode>::tenant_create::{closure#0} 0
<control_plane::pageserver::PageServerNode>::tenant_list 12
::tenant_list 6
::tenant_list::{closure#0} 6
<control_plane::pageserver::PageServerNode>::tenant_secondary_download 0
::tenant_secondary_download 0
::tenant_secondary_download::{closure#0} 0
<control_plane::pageserver::PageServerNode>::tenant_synthetic_size 0
<control_plane::pageserver::PageServerNode>::tenant_synthetic_size::{closure#0} 0
<control_plane::pageserver::PageServerNode>::timeline_create 0
<control_plane::pageserver::PageServerNode>::timeline_create::{closure#0} 0
<control_plane::pageserver::PageServerNode>::timeline_import 6
<control_plane::pageserver::PageServerNode>::timeline_import::{closure#0} 6
<control_plane::pageserver::PageServerNode>::timeline_import::{closure#0}::{closure#0} 6
<control_plane::pageserver::PageServerNode>::timeline_import::{closure#0}::{closure#1} 8
<control_plane::pageserver::PageServerNode>::timeline_import::{closure#0}::{closure#1}::{closure#0} 8
<control_plane::pageserver::PageServerNode>::timeline_import::{closure#0}::{closure#1}::{closure#0}::{closure#0} 0
<control_plane::pageserver::PageServerNode>::timeline_list 19
<control_plane::pageserver::PageServerNode>::timeline_list::{closure#0} 19

Generated by: LCOV version 2.1-beta